Nmysql database administration tutorial pdf

Below are some instructions to help you get mysql up and running in a few easy steps. Login system tutorial with php and mysql database youtube. During the conference, exams can be taken any evening. Mysql basic database administration commands part i tecmint.

The book starts with the fundamentals of mysql database management, including mysql s unique approach to sql queries, data and index types, stored procedures and functions, triggers. The administration part 1 course then is the foundation for those more complex topics that well talk about in the administration course part 2. Mysql basic database administration commands part i. Before you attempt to get the exams, you need to understand its all levels of assurance. If you are using mysql workbench commercial editions, see the mysql workbench commercial license information user manual for licensing information, including licensing information relating to thirdparty software that may be included in this commercial edition release.

Mysql administrator is, to a large extent, the result of feedback received from many users over a period of several years. To restore your database from backup, using the import tab in phpmyadmin is the easiest and most straightforward option. There are a large number of database management systems currently available, some commercial and some free. Mysql is an open source relational database management system rdbms that will make use of structured query language, sql, to add, access, and manage content in a database. Migrate to azure sql database or provision a new sql database. Mysql database administrator interview questions glassdoor.

Complete script to get missing structural changes between two schemas in mysql. Mysql database administration certification questions answers. Mysql is a relational database management system based on the structured query language, which is the popular language for accessing and managing the records in the database. Despite its powerful features, mysql is simple to set up and easy to use. This chapter provides an overview of mysql server and covers general server administration. For help with using mysql, please visit the mysql forums, where you can discuss your issues with other mysql. This tutorial will provide a quick introduction to mariadb and aid you in achieving a high level of comfort with mariadb programming and administration. This tutorial is prepared for the beginners to help them understand the basicstoadvanced concepts related to mysql. Sql for mysql developers a comprehensive tutorial and reference rick f.

These includes server maintenance, database backup, mysql security, user management, start upshutdown, replication management, configuration of parameters resource management, check performance status etc. Chapter 1 tutorial this chapter provides a tutorial introduction to mysql by showing how to use the mysql client program to create and use a simple database. Mysql for oracle dudes terminology database files database server instance database instance memory database server instance. Today, i came across an useful postgresql database administration commands series. Mysql provides various administration featurestools to configure the mysql server. The certificate will testify skills to install, maintain, administer and optimize mysql servers. This tutorial will summarize the chapters covered by the first part. The visual console enables dbas to easily perform operations such as configuring servers, administering users, export and import, and viewing logs. Learning mysql download free course intituled learning mysql, a pdf document created by stackoverflow documentation, a 300page tutorial on the basics of this language to learn and manipulate databases created with mysql. Database administration consists of everything required to manage a database and make it available as needed. Its well written, to the point, and covers the topics that you need to know to become an effective dba. Mysql tutorial pdf this is the mysql tutorial from the mysql 5.

The number of databases is not limited on any of the virtual or vip webhosting tariffs. Mysql tutorials and tips fyi center for database administrators. Below is an example of adding new user guest with select, insert. This is a neat tutorial which will help you in mysql database administration. Learn four system databases in sql server, master, msdb, tempdb and model.

Clear answers and sample scripts provided can be used as learning tutorials or interview preparation guides. Mysql is the worlds most popular opensource database. Give a quick introduction to databases and mysql as a relational database management system rdbms show you step by step how to install mysql server on your computer for practicing with the tutorials. To see what database is selected mysql select database. Gain indemand skills to scale database applications and validate your expertise with mysql. Scott ambler, thought leader, agile data method this is a wellwritten, wellorganized guide to the practice of database. Mysql tutorial mysql performance schema mysql replication using the mysql yum repository. Mysql is developed, marketed and supported by mysql ab, which is a swedish company. Database names are case sensitive to the select a database, issue the use command. A free inside look at mysql database administrator interview questions and process details for 10 companies all posted anonymously by interview candidates. Over 2000 isvs, oems, and vars rely on mysql as their products embedded database to make their applications, hardware and appliances more competitive, bring them to market. In this article, we will learn the basics of sql server database administration. This is a collection of tutorials and tips for mysql dba and developers.

Mysql tutorial pdf mysql tutorial pdf mysql tutorial pdf download. Mysql database administration training and certification. The concept of database was known to our ancestors even when there were no computers, however creating and maintaining such database was very tedious job. In the section mysql you can administer mysql databases. This course starts with database basics, normalization and mysql workbench installation. Start mysql server show you how to start the mysql server on windows and linux. Administration mysql workbench integrates database administration tools into a simple to use graphical user interface. This manual describes features that are not included in every edition of mysql 5. Oct 10, 2014 create a mysql database and user through cpanel linux vps hosting blog are different ways to create a mysql database and user. Foster city, ca chicago, il indianapolis, in new york, ny 35374 fm. We also explain how to perform some basic operations with mysql using the mysql.

Mysql workbench integrates database administration tools into a simple to use graphical user interface. How to become a database administrator for mysql idera. Learn to master complex features and functions with mysql database administration training courses. In this video, we will go over the basics of the postgresql. This stepbystep tutorial gives you indepth background information on mysql administration. If you arent familiar with mysql, creating a database and table is a simple process that requires a user. This section cover everything from basic to advanced mysql administration and configuration. So this complete database course and will surely help you become a database design guru.

In this ebook course, professional azure sql database administration, youll get detailed, easytofollow guidance and activity plans on how to. Moreover, postgresql provides comparable features like oracle. Mysql administrators bible is designed to provide a solid framework for a beginning mysql dba or an experienced dba transitioning from another database platform. The ultimate guide on how to become a database administrator. This book can be used as both a tutorial and a reference. Filter by location to see mysql database administrator salaries in your area. Mysql for oracle dudes mysql data dictionary sql examples select s. Basic mysql database administration on a linux vps rosehosting. In this mysql tutorial you will learn how to build connection of database. Government rights programs, software, databases, and related.

Mysql for database administrators, the mysql for database administrators enables dbas and other database professionals to maximize their organizations investment in mysql. The data directory, particularly the mysql system database. This is just a survey of the tasks that you will perform as a database administrator and how to do those things in their most basic form. Your contribution will go a long way in helping us. Our mysql learning paths included within the mysql learning subscription provides required and suggested courses to help you achieve your training goals and prepare for an industryrecognized oracle certification. Learn mysql and database design free tutorials for. The next units will teach you sql and advance sql and you will also learn to use php with mysql. A simple guide to mysql basic database administration commands. Mysql server mysqld is the main program that does most of the work in a mysql installation. Mysql dba tutorials for the beginners training videos. Mysql tutorial provides basic and advanced concepts of mysql. For adding a new user to mysql, you just need to add a new entry to the user table in the database mysql. If your mysql is running, then you will see mysqld process listed out in your result. This manual describes the php extensions and interfaces that can be used with mysql.

Feb 02, 2017 php login system tutorial, using mysql database and sessions, which includes registration, login, log out, and reset password functionality. Learn to configure the mysql server, set up replication and security, perform database. Azure sql database administration ebook microsoft azure. Mysql is the most popular open source relational sql database management system. Easily create and manage online mysql backups using the workbench gui for mysql. Database design, normalization, structure mapping, keys and junction tables comes next. In this article weve compiled some very useful mysqladmin. About the tutorial mariadb is a fork of the mysql relational database management system. Our mysql tutorial is designed for beginners and professionals. Easily create and manage online mysql backups using the workbench gui for. Mysql is a popular choice of database for use in web applications, and is a central component of the widely used lamp open source web application software stack.

Mysql query optimizer is an important component of the mysql. To simultaneously create a user, assign a password, and grant access. One of the attractive features of mysql is the strict security it gives your data. The tradeoff is some extra work for the database administrator. We will cover topics ranging from installations, to writing basic queries and retrieving data from tables. First check if your mysql server is running or not. This tutorial will give you a quick start to mysql and make you comfortable with mysql programming. The data directory, particularly the mysql system schema. Management of multiple servers on a single machine. Now days passing mysql database administration certification exams are not easy and simple. Now, if you want to shut down an already running mysql server, then you can.

A mysql enterprise subscription is the most comprehensive offering of mysql database software, services and support. If server is not running, then you can start it by using the following command. Mysql database administration certification questions answers dumps. In one of our previous blog articles about mysql basic mysql database administration on linux vps part 2 rosehosting blog to find out how to create and manage databases and. However, if you find its lacking some feature important to you, or if you discover a bug, please use ourmysql bug system to re.

Mysql administrator is a program for performing administrative operations, such as configuring, monitoring and starting and stopping a mysql server, managing users and connections, performing backups, and a number of other administrative tasks. The mysql dba certification exam will make you a certified mysql dba. I would highly recommend following articles for the beginners to get hands on experience quickly in the postgresql database administration. The database administrator dba is the person who manages, backs up and ensures the.

The concept of database was known to our ancestors even when there were no computers, however creating and maintaining such database. Mysql tutorial in pdf learn mysql from basic to advanced covering database programming clauses command functions administration queries and usage along with php in simple steps. In this section, you will find a lot of useful mysql administration tutorials including server startup and shutdown, user security, database maintenance, and. This section helps you get started with mysql quickly if you have never worked with mysql before. Start mysql server show you how to start the mysql. For adding a new user to mysqli which is improved version of mysql, you just need to add a new entry to user table in database mysql. This tutorial will go over some of the fundamentals of mysql database administration and security. Oracle and mysql on several different unix servers, microsoft sql server. Using a database to create a new database, issue the create database command. Mysql administrator is designed to work with mysql versions 4. Mysql administration first check if your mysql server is running or not. Dec 06, 2010 this covers all aspects of mysql database administration including mysql server tuning, query optimization, index tuning, managing storage engines, caching, authentication and managing users, partitioning and replication, logging, database and performance monitoring, security, backup and recovery, managing availability and scaling.

Accolades for database administration ive forgotten how many times ive recommended this book to people. The original developers of mysql created mariadb after concerns raised by oracles acquisition of mysql. Database is a structured set of data stored electronically. Salary estimates are based on 12,661 salaries submitted anonymously to glassdoor by mysql database administrator employees.

Sep 14, 2015 this video covers some basic mysql administration tasks creating, restoring, and backing up a mysql database, as well as basic user account management. This video covers some basic mysql administration tasks creating, restoring, and backing up a mysql database, as well as basic user account management. This chapter provides a tutorial introduction to mysql by showing how to use the mysql client program to create and use a simple database. Mysql provides several useful statements that allow you to maintain database tables effectively. Those statements enable you to analyze, optimize, check, and repair database tables. All mysql administration tutorials presented in this section are practical and widely used in the enterprise.